**ADG774BRQ: A 5 Ω, 4-Channel CMOS Analog Multiplexer in a 16-Lead TSSOP Package**
In the realm of precision signal routing and switching, the performance of an analog multiplexer is paramount. The **ADG774BRQ** stands out as a high-performance, monolithic CMOS device engineered to provide **ultra-low on-resistance of just 5 Ω** with exceptional flatness across the analog input range. This 4-channel single-pole/double-throw (SPDT) switch is designed to handle a wide spectrum of signals, making it an indispensable component in a variety of demanding applications.

Housed in a compact **16-lead TSSOP package**, the ADG774BRQ is ideal for space-constrained PCB designs. Its architecture ensures minimal power consumption, a critical feature for portable and battery-operated equipment. The device operates from a single **+3 V to +5.5 V supply**, making it perfectly suited for interfacing with modern low-voltage microcontrollers and digital signal processors. Furthermore, it offers **TTL and CMOS-compatible digital inputs**, which simplifies interface logic and eliminates the need for level-shifting circuitry.
The exceptionally low and flat on-resistance ensures minimal signal distortion when switching analog voltages, preserving the integrity of critical signals in measurement and data acquisition systems. This characteristic, combined with fast switching speeds and high bandwidth, makes the ADG774BRQ an excellent choice for applications such as **battery-powered communication devices, medical instrumentation, audio and video signal routing, and automated test equipment (ATE)**.
